AGCO (NYSE: AGCO) is a global leader in the design, manufacture and distribution of agricultural solutions. Our portfolio of international brands, including Fendt®, GSI®, Massey Ferguson® and Valtra®, provides smart and effective agricultural solutions to farmers around the world – including a full line of tractors, combine harvesters, hay and forage equipment, seeding and tillage implements, grain handling, seed processing and animal protein production systems. With global sales of approximately USD 12.7 billion in 2022, AGCO’s international team of over 24,000 employees work together to deliver high-tech solutions for farmers feeding the world. IT Analyst - Programmer

Hybrid Working – Stoneleigh, Warwickshire

Job Summary

The IT Analyst/Programmer – Dealer Portal is an integral part of the Product Teams in the Agile Software Delivery Process. The IT Analyst I – Dealer Portal enriches the team in the areas of Requirements Analysis, Design, Development, Testing and Production Support.

Requirements Analysis

  • Refinement of User Stories and Features
  • Methodical support in generating ideas with Product Owners and Subject Matter Experts
  • Definition of the integration points with other systems and communication of the effects of possible system changes in cooperation with other teams
  • Support in estimating efforts for new developments and improvements
  • Knowledge transfer for new and changed functions for the change management process

Design & Development

  • Contribution to the definition of wireframes and visual designs
  • Maintaining and managing all software applications and protocols
  • Designing and developing new enhanced functionality for software applications
  • Translating business needs and requirements into programming languages
  • Create reusable, effective, and scalable code

Continuous Testing

  • Quality assurance of the implementation of technical and functional requirements
  • Planning and execution of tests
  • Definition of test conditions and scripts
  • Analysis of test results

Production Support

  • Successful processing of dealer inquiries for troubleshooting and changes as part of the AGCO IT incident process
  • Good problem solving and error analysis
  • Monitoring of the system uptime

General

  • Active participation and preparation for agile ceremonies such as Product Increment Planning, Sprint Planning, Refinements, Sprint Reviews and Retrospectives
  • Responsibility for compliance with all AGCO guidelines by all employees and teams, as well as compliance with all control processes and standards

Qualifications / Experience

  • Bachelor`s / Master`s degree in computer science, IT, engineering, or equivalent education
  • Several years of professional experience
  • Relevant experience in software development
  • Knowledge of agile methods (e.g. SAFe) is an advantage
  • Experience in requirements engineering, testing and production support is desirable
  • Analytical comprehensive thinking
  • Good communication skills in spoken and written English
  • Independent and solution-oriented behaviour
  • Strong analytical, holistic and conceptual thinking
  • Proven Experience with SQL/MySQL
  • Hands on experience on HTML/CSS/JavaScript/JQuery
  • Hands on experience on C#/ASP.Net (classic .ASP)
  • Hands on experience in integrating SOAP/Restful web services/JSON
  • Experience and knowledge of Portals
